How to fill out the Beason Hammon Alabama Taxpayer Form online
Completing the Beason Hammon Alabama Taxpayer Form is essential for those involved in motor fuel activities in Alabama. This guide will provide clear, step-by-step instructions to help users fill out the form online, ensuring compliance and accuracy.

- Begin by filling out section A for applicant information, including the legal business or corporation name, FEIN or SSN, trade name, contact details, and email address.
- In section B, provide accurate address information, including the physical location, mailing address if different, and the address for business records.
- Section C requires you to check the licenses you are applying for such as supplier, importer, or terminal operator. Include an entity number if applicable.
- In section D, indicate your type of business ownership and provide related details such as state of incorporation and date of incorporation if your business is a corporation or LLC.
- Complete section E by checking the types of products you will handle, providing the appropriate product codes.
- Section F asks for information about motor fuel purchase and receipt details. Enter all applicable suppliers' names and details.
- If applicable, fill out section G with terminal operator information, detailing your storage and distribution facilities.
- Fill out sections H through O based on your business type, providing necessary information if you own a refinery, transport motor fuel, or are involved in other related activities.
- Complete section P for storage facility information, ensuring all storage facilities are accounted for, both owned and leased.
- In section Q, if you are a permissive supplier, complete the tax pre-collection agreement.
- Finally, certify the completion of the application in section R, ensuring all details are accurate before submitting.

Yes, Alabama requires E-Verify as part of its efforts to enforce immigration laws effectively. Employers in the state must use the E-Verify system to confirm the employment eligibility of new hires.
